Specific majors offered
14 specific majors with reported completions. Earnings shown are median annual earnings 1 year after graduation; debt is median student-loan debt at graduation.
| Major | Credential | Grads | Median earnings | Median debt |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Health Professions and Related Clinical Sciences, Other. | Master's | 256 | — | — |
| Medicine. | First professional | 222 | $64,777 | — |
| Allied Health Diagnostic, Intervention, and Treatment Professions. | Master's | 96 | $114,311 | — |
| Physiology, Pathology and Related Sciences. | Doctoral | 37 | — | — |
| Pharmacology and Toxicology. | Doctoral | 28 | — | — |
| Neurobiology and Neurosciences. | Doctoral | 24 | — | — |
| Biochemistry, Biophysics and Molecular Biology. | Doctoral | 23 | — | — |
| Cell/Cellular Biology and Anatomical Sciences. | Doctoral | 23 | — | — |
| Biomathematics, Bioinformatics, and Computational Biology. | Master's | 19 | — | — |
| Health Professions and Related Clinical Sciences, Other. | Graduate certificate | 19 | — | — |
| Ecology, Evolution, Systematics, and Population Biology. | Master's | 16 | — | — |
| Microbiological Sciences and Immunology. | Doctoral | 15 | — | — |
| Ecology, Evolution, Systematics, and Population Biology. | Graduate certificate | 14 | — | — |
| Biomathematics, Bioinformatics, and Computational Biology. | Doctoral | 10 | — | — |
Source: U.S. Department of Education, College Scorecard Field of Study. Earnings cover graduates who received federal financial aid and are working / not enrolled. Cells marked "—" are not reported or were suppressed for privacy.
